Market Insights on Australia Smart Pole Market• Australia's smart pole market has undergone a significant transformation over the past five years, evolving from isolated pilot projects into a coordinated national infrastructure priority. Bradfield City, Australia's first new city to be built in 100 years, stands at the forefront of this transformation. According to the research report, "Australia Smart Poles Market Overview, 2031," published by Actual Market Research Research, the Australia Smart Poles market is anticipated to grow at 19.96% CAGR from 2026 to 2031.• The Bradfield Development Authority (BDA), a NSW Government agency, has partnered with Australian telecommunications company Superloop to deliver critical infrastructure services, including managing public lighting across Bradfield for 20 years. The first 101 Multi-Function Poles (MFPs) will host public lighting, signage, banners, telecommunications equipment, CCTV, bike charging, and environmental sensors, with free public Wi-Fi and improved mobile reception ensuring high-speed connectivity.• Melbourne is trialing eight smart poles in Fishermans Bend Australia's largest urban renewal project covering 480 hectares as part of the Gateway to the General Motors Holden (GMH) project. The ENE.HUB SMART.POLEs host sensors for transport, noise, weather, and air quality data, with LoRaWAN gateways for connectivity.• The Australian Local Government Association (ALGA) and Council of Capital City Lord Mayors (CCCLM) published the Multi-Function Pole Best Practice Guide in August 2025, providing comprehensive guidance on planning, procurement, installation, and management. The Australian Communications and Media Authority (ACMA) has confirmed that Telstra, Optus, and Vodafone will install small cells on smart light pole systems, combining lighting, Wi-Fi, and mobile coverage.Competitive Landscape of Australia Smart Pole Market• Multipole, a product of the Goldspar Australia Group based in Sydney, has been designing multifunctional aluminium poles since 1979, with founder Douglas Rawson-Harris developing the first ever multifunction light pole system, the award-winning Smartpole, in 1997. The company's Telco Smart Series accommodates 4G/5G technology, while its City Smart Series includes Pedestrian Priority Zone solutions.• ENE.HUB supplies the SMART.POLEs being trialed in Melbourne's Fishermans Bend.

HUB Australasia Pty Ltd, an award-winning international company, has designed and delivered over 1,000 pieces of urban infrastructure to local government and private contractors across Australia. • Urban Aluminium Pty Ltd, established in 2018, specialises in IoT-ready Multi-function Poles. The value chain is shifting toward integrated solutions combining connectivity, surveillance, and environmental monitoring. Entry barriers remain substantial, requiring compliance with Australian Standards (AS3000) and Energy Australia Standard NS 137 for Multi-Functional Poles.• Investment is flowing through multiple channels, with the Australian Renewable Energy Agency (ARENA) providing a AU$871,000 grant towards Intellihub's $2.04 million project installing 50 EV chargers on power poles in the Sydney metro area. Essential Energy, in partnership with Wagners Composite Fibre Technologies and EVX, is deploying 300 composite streetlight columns with integrated 7kW chargers ready for lease by charge point operators. Australia Market DynamicsDriver: Large-Scale Greenfield Urban DevelopmentBradfield City represents Australia's most significant smart pole deployment catalyst, with the BDA signing a 20-year partnership with Superloop to manage public lighting and operate 101 Multi-Function Poles. The precinct will eventually house 10,000 homes and 20,000 jobs, with subsequent phases expected to expand the smart pole portfolio significantly. This long-term commercial partnership, relatively unique in Australia, provides a replicable model for future large-scale developments.Challenge: Deployment Costs and Regional Infrastructure GapsThe substantial upfront capital expenditure for smart pole installation represents a significant barrier to widespread adoption across Australia's vast geography.

ARENA has identified that deployment costs and process burdens for charge point operators are compounded by lower asset utilisation and higher maintenance costs in regional areas compared to metropolitan centres. This infrastructure gap between urban and rural communities remains a persistent challenge for equitable smart pole deployment.Trend: Integrated EV Charging InfrastructureElectric vehicle charging integration is emerging as a defining trend in Australia's smart pole market. Essential Energy's Plug and Play project, supported by ARENA, will accelerate deployment of up to 1,300 kerbside charging points 1,000 enabled wooden power poles and 300 new composite streetlight columns with built-in 7kW chargers. The composite pole with an in-column charger represents a novel technology in Australia. Intellihub has already completed 50 EV charger installations on power poles in the Sydney metro area with a AU$871,000 ARENA grant. Segment AnalysisAustralia Smart Pole Software Market by Component• Hardware forms the physical foundation of Australia's smart pole infrastructure, encompassing durable LED lighting lamps, composite pole brackets, communication devices, and intelligent controllers. Bradfield City's street lighting consists of modern LEDs with smart controls that automatically download asset information, provide GPS location, enable dimming in off-peak periods, report energy consumption, and provide automatic fault reporting.

Essential Energy's composite fibreglass columns represent an innovative Australian-developed hardware solution.• Software platforms are rapidly emerging as the strategic differentiator, enabling centralized management, real-time monitoring, and predictive maintenance. Bradfield's lights are equipped with Zhaga interface sensor ports, an international industry standard similar to USB for outdoor environments, enabling inexpensive deployment of future sensors for traffic, climate, pollutants, and noise levels. Superloop and OneWiFi will manage the MFPs, with multiple power and fibre connections to each pole supporting data-hungry applications.• The service segment encompasses installation, maintenance, data analytics, and cybersecurity management. The ALGA and CCCLM's Multi-Function Pole Best Practice Guide includes a model General Facilities Access Agreement to streamline negotiations with telecommunications providers, supporting the rollout of small cell 4G/5G technology. Essential Energy's NEXUS Innovation Hub conducts destructive materials testing and accelerated aging to ensure composite products perform over extended adverse environmental conditions.Australia Smart Pole Software Market by Installation Type• New installations are deployed in greenfield developments and major urban renewal projects. Bradfield City's 101 Multi-Function Poles represent comprehensive new installation, with the lighting portfolio expected to grow significantly as subsequent phases are developed.

Melbourne's Fishermans Bend pilot features eight new ENE.HUB SMART.POLEs installed between September 2023 and March 2024.• Retrofit installations offer cost-effective pathways to smart pole adoption, converting existing infrastructure without new foundations. Essential Energy's Stream 1 Pole Enablement involves conducting enablement works on 1,000 existing wooden power poles, leasing sites to charge point operators to connect their own charging hardware. Parramatta Council has undertaken a smart LED energy efficiency street lighting upgrade project in partnership with Endeavour Energy, upgrading more than 4,500 lights.Australia Smart Pole Software Market by Application• Smart transportation leads Australian smart pole applications, with adaptive lighting improving safety and energy efficiency. City of Parramatta's project features tailoring lighting at different times in response to traffic and pedestrian usage to conserve power. Multipole's City Smart Series includes Pedestrian Priority Zone solutions for roadways. Bradfield's MFPs include bike charging capabilities.• Public spaces benefit from smart poles providing environmental monitoring, lighting, and safety services.

Melbourne's smart poles gather data on transport, noise, weather, and air quality. Rockhampton's smart poles feature LED lighting, digital signage, smart CCTV, parking bay sensors, and free public Wi-Fi. The City of Sydney's smart poles support RTA signals, street lighting, communications, CCTV, signage, and lighting.• Industrial applications at railways leverage smart poles for connectivity and security. The ACMA confirms that Telstra, Optus, and Vodafone install small cells on light poles, tram poles, and smart light pole systems. Small cells also feature on railway stations. Essential Energy's composite poles are being trialed for deployment in regional transport corridors.• Corporate campuses and parking lots deploy smart poles for security surveillance, occupancy monitoring, and EV charging.

Rockhampton's smart parking sensors were funded by the Federal Government Smart Cities and Suburbs Grant. Intellihub's 50 EV charger installations on power poles in the Sydney metro area demonstrate the viability of pole-mounted charging in parking and campus environments. Essential Energy's composite streetlight columns with integrated 7kW chargers are designed for destination charging applications.
